Temporary contractor role as an employee of Atrium assigned to work at Humana.
The UM Administration Coordinator 2 supports the administration of utilization management for providers. This role is responsible for performing advanced administrative, operational, and customer support tasks that require independent initiative and sound judgment. The position also demands strong problem‑solving skills to address and facilitate Humana members’ access to care needs.
Job DescriptionAs a Utilization Management Coordinator 2, you will be an integral part of a fast‑paced, metric‑driven team responsible for managing prior authorization requests from providers and members. The role involves sitting at a desk throughout the day and handling approximately 30–50 inbound calls from providers, with future opportunities to assist with member calls.
